What is Telepresence?

Telepresence is a group of technologies aimed at connecting people far apart instantly with a superbly real time rendering. It consists on a combination of multiple high-definition monitors, cameras, microphones, speakers and custom-made studios. It brings the concept of a video conference forward, revolutionizing interaction.

What’s the trend?

According to Frost & Sullivan Telepresence will grow immensely through 2013 due to the use of new technologies and the need to be connected with colleagues, partners and customers in an instant offering a great human interaction.

Who offers it?

There are several corporations inn the market such a Cisco, Hewlett-Packard (Halo), Telanetix (Video Telepresence), Polycom or Sony (3D Telepresence). Since the need of connectivity keeps growing constantly several organizations like Marriott and Starwood hotels have already made partnership with vendors to improve their business offering.

Benefits

Besides giving the illusion of being in the same room, capturing the body language and giving less exhaustion to users, Telepresence offers much more benefits such as:

- Real time connectivity
- Instant connection
- Sharp sound
- Quality, size and clarity of images
- Doesn’t bother and stress with unwanted latency
- Increases productivity
- Enhances communication

    Kena:

    Would you consider Skype a telepresence technology?

    I've participated as a virtual attendee in an unconference in California. I was sitting at my home in Dallas, TX, USA at my desk interacting with other attendees located onsite in the San Francisco venue. The speaker used Skype to broadcast her presentation from New Zealand as it was projected on a screen in a the meeting venue. It was an interesting experience and we all felt connected in a unique way even though several of us were thousands of miles apart from each other.

    I think telepresence technology provides another great opportunity and a new avenue for meeting and event organizers to consider when planning their meetings. It will be interesting to see if and how the meetings industry adopts this new technology into their conferences and events.

    Hi Jeff,

    I think Skype is video conferencing. Since you were using your camera from your computer, even though you were able to see everyone on the screen, what Telepresence offers is big screens in order to be able to see other people life size, so you can see their body language and even have eye contact with a group of people at the same time.

    A few hotel chains are implementing this kind of technology, Marriott hotels will have it in some of their venues by October this year. And I really think that with all these benefits, mainly being able to see the other person so realistic will make trust grow faster among people and use it more for corporate business, affecting eventually the travel industry.

    Lets see how meeting industry adopts it as you said.

    Hi Kena,

    When I think of Telepresence, I think of this video by CISCO, where they had the speaker walk on stage from 14K miles away. http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=rcfNC_x0VvE

    Having said that I can see how the CISCO and SONY technologies would be a huge benefit to corporate meetings that are between 10 and 60 people in size. Rather than flying this people around Europe or the US for a 1/2 day meeting, they can all just go to their local Mariott or Starwood without having to travel. You would still get to see a life sized person, read non-verbal cues, etc. So, I think it would really work for these smaller meetings.
